Is nostalgia without longing still nostalgia
Or do I need to find a different word
For looking back into the past without longing
Maybe there isn’t a word for it
Maybe a bunch of words is needed
To convey the emotion
Of remembering bygone times without wishing to return to them
I remember many such times
Every life is crammed with them, I dare say
Dabs of regret here and there
But also rainbows of joy at recollections
Of moments of supreme bliss
Of being somewhere
Of being in someone’s company
Of doing something
And not wanting to be anywhere else
At one time those moments were in the future
Until they landed in the present
And drifted to the irretrievable past
I remind the silliest person I know
Because I know him so well
Because I don’t allow him to hide from my honesty
To never leave the present
Because it’s my only opportunity
To eradicate seeds of regret before they sprout
To savour the joy of my existence
To be grateful
To desire what I have
